The Diffrient office chair collection includes numerous elements characterized by different properties and different alternatives based on each person's taste or the different needs that one prefers to option. The mechanism at the base of each seat is called "gravity", a device patented by Niels Diffrient that uses the laws of physics and the weight of the person's body to support every posture and every desired angle without any need for external and mechanical adjustments. A system, in practice, that automatically adapts to the body and lives in symbiosis with it, ensuring a maximum sensation of comfort during the day. The design of this line is inspired by the world of clothing, of which it exploits not only the taste but also fabrics and lines to assume elegant, sophisticated and current aesthetic solutions.
